The marketplace being a competitive battlefield is primarily due to __________.
A) the ongoing race among rivals to achieve the fastest rate of growth in revenues and profits.
B) the ongoing efforts of industry members to introduce innovative products/services as fast followers into the marketplace.
C) the ability of industry rivals to build strong defenses against the industry's driving forces.
D) the constant rivalry of firms to strengthen buyer patronage among competing sellers of a product or service, in order to win a competitive edge over rivals.
E) the efforts of industry incumbents to lower cost products/services at a faster rate than their rivals.
D) the constant rivalry of firms to strengthen buyer patronage among competing sellers of a product or service, in order to win a competitive edge over rivals.
The strongest of the five competitive forces is often the rivalry for buyer patronage among competing sellers of a product or service.
